The Industrial Mining Production Index (IPI miner) of Argentina reflected in April 2025 a recovery trend, with an increase of 1.6% over the same month of the previous year, and an accumulated growth of 2.1% in the first four months of the year. In addition, the seasonalized series of the index showed an increase of 0.9% over the previous month, indicating a slight reactivation of the mining sector after years of uncertainty. La Paz, Jun 10, 2025 (ATB Digital).- The social conflicts that the country is going through are also hitting the mining sector. One of its representatives warned that the economic losses are increasingly worrying, affecting both the production and the income of hundreds of families that depend on this activity.
